• After Poland Germany is the most endangered area to forestfires in Central Europe

• Endangered are particularly the eastern federal states

From 858 FF in Germany 2009 there were 470 cases in East G.

• Particularly affected by forest fires is the federal state of Brandenburg

• Reasons are climatic conditions (driest state), associated with sandy soils which store very little precipitation

• In addition there is a high proportion of pine (70 %) which is particularly vulnerable concerning fires

Technical Data of the MODIS-Sensor

• Flight height: 705 km

• Strip width: 2330 km

• Spatial Resolution: 250m /500m /1000m

• Radiometric Resolution: 12 bit (4096 grayscales)

• Spectral Resolution: 36 bands

(0,405µm -14,385µm)

• Temporal Resolution: 1 day

• Passing time at Equator : 10:30 (Terra), 13:30 (Aqua)

• Orbit: Terra (north to south), Aqua (south to north)

• MODIS Active Fire Data is not suitable for a fire monitoring in

Germany

• According to aspect, there is influence visible to forest fires in

Brandenburg and Northern Portugal

• According to the infrastructure (road buffers) a influence could be also confirmed

• Remote Sensing Data, especially MODIS, is very suitable for

research particulary on global scale
